Induction hobs

Induction hobs have smooth, flat surfaces that are much easier than gas hobs to wash. They consume less energy and also offer precise temperature control, making them perfect for delicate sauces and searing meats. They also cool quickly, so you don't burn your fingers when you touch the surface. You will need to use a set of cookware that is compatible to use these. They are not suitable for people who have pacemakers because the electromagnetic field created by induction may interfere.

A majority of induction hobs come with indicators that show power levels and settings, bringing an air of futuristic design to your kitchen. Some models come with bridge zones, which allow you to mix cooking zones to accommodate larger pans. This makes them a great option for grilling pans and griddles. There are also models equipped with a boost function which temporarily increases the power output of the zone, allowing it to bring water up to boiling point or sear meat faster.

A residual heat indicator is an additional useful feature. It will show that the stove is hot even after it's been shut off. This can help prevent accidental burns, especially when you have children in your household. Some hobs also have child locks to ensure your children are secure while you cook.

Gas hobs

Gas hobs are a staple of UK kitchens, thanks to their ability to provide instant heat and precise temperature control. They also sport sleek and professional looks that can be integrated into a variety of kitchen designs. In addition, most modern gas hobs feature automatic ignition. Turning on the stove will ignite the gas inside the burner with an electric spark. This is much safer than the older gas hobs, which required the use of matchboxes or lighters. The visual flame indicator of gas hobs allows you to know whether the flame is lit or off which can prevent accidental burns and gas leaks.

There are a variety of different choices available for gas hobs ranging from simple single-burner designs to large, power-filled wok burners. Some models even include dual flame burners that permit users to alter the size of the flame and control the heat. Other features include vortex flames that reduce heat loss from the sides and a sleek, durable surface that is easy to clean.

Solid-plate hobs

Solid plate hobs are a dependable and simple cooking solution that has been a staple in a variety of homes for a long time. Electricity is used to heat flat metal plates, which makes this an affordable option that is easy to maintain and use. However, their basic design isn't as efficient than other hob types and result in higher electricity bills. They also take longer to cool and heat up than other hobs. This can be frustrating for those who are used to cooking more quickly.

A budget-friendly option, solid plate hobs provide even heating distribution and are compatible with most kinds of pans and pots. They also have simple dial controls to regulate the temperature. They also feature an indicator light that indicates when the plate is hot or turned on to ensure safety.

However the solid plate design can be prone to short circuits in electrical current and could require more maintenance than other hob designs. They also tend to be less flexible than other kinds of hobs, such as induction and ceramic.
